Benefits of market segmentation
gulaghasi [49]

Answer:  Market segmentation allows you to target your content to the right people in the right way, rather than targeting your entire audience with a generic message. This helps you increase the chances of people engaging with your ad or content, resulting in more efficient campaigns and improved return on investment (ROI).Mar 11, 2019

Question 2 (2 points) 2) When locating an online or print source, which of the following is a good question to ask yourself? (se
denpristay [2]

Answer:

a. Is the source credible? Is this source self-published (like a blog or Q/A forum), is there no author listed, does this organization publishing look like a credible source?

b. How old is this source? When was this source published. Does the topic of your paper require current source, or will older publications still be relevant?

d. Is the writing propaganda, opinion or fact? After reading the source, does the source appear to try and persuade you to one way or another, or does the source appear to state facts. When stating facts, does the source cite ITS sources properly?
